Construction has started on Ankeny Market & Pavilion

Construction is underway for the $2 million Ankeny Market & Pavilion. The project is being led by the city of Ankeny and the Ankeny Rotary Club. So far, $1.75 million has been donated for the AMP, which will provide the primary trailhead for the 26-mile High Trestle Trail that runs from Ankeny to Woodward. The AMP will include two open-air shelters, which will house the Ankeny Uptown Farmers Market and a variety of community activities; a restroom building; 108 parking spaces; and other open green space. Fundraising efforts began in December 2012. Pending additional fundraising, the goal is to have the AMP completed next year.
